|
Net Assets - Cash Distributions (Details) - USD ($)
$ / shares in Units, $ in Thousands
|9 Months Ended
|
Sep. 30, 2025
|
Aug. 29, 2025
|
Jul. 31, 2025
|
Jun. 30, 2025
|
May 30, 2025
|
Apr. 30, 2025
|
Mar. 31, 2025
|
Feb. 28, 2025
|
Jan. 31, 2025
|
Sep. 30, 2024
|
Aug. 30, 2024
|
Jul. 31, 2024
|
Jun. 28, 2024
|
May 31, 2024
|
Apr. 30, 2024
|
Mar. 29, 2024
|
Feb. 29, 2024
|
Jan. 31, 2024
|
Sep. 30, 2025
|
Sep. 30, 2024
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|$ 0.72900
|$ 0.72900
|February 25, 2025 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|March 25, 2025 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|April 24, 2025 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.10280
|May 23, 2025 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|June 25, 2025 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|July 24, 2025 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.10280
|O 2025 M7 Dividends
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|O 2025 M8 Dividends
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|O 2025 M9 Dividends
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|$ 0.10280
|February 23, 2024 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|March 22, 2024 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|April 23, 2024 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.10280
|May 22, 2023 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|June 26, 2023 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|July 24, 2024 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.10280
|August 22, 2024 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|September 25, 2024 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|0.07010
|October 24, 2024 Payment Date
|Class of Stock [Line Items]
|Cash distribution (in usd per share)
|$ 0.10280
|Class S common stock
|Class of Stock [Line Items]
|Distribution Amount
|$ 403,783
|$ 275,076
|Class S common stock | February 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 33,890
|Class S common stock | March 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 35,308
|Class S common stock | April 24,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 54,669
|Class S common stock | May 23,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 37,635
|Class S common stock | June 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 38,551
|Class S common stock | July 24,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 59,206
|Class S common stock | O 2025 M7 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|$ 40,040
|Class S common stock | O 2025 M8 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|$ 41,248
|Class S common stock | O 2025 M9 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|$ 63,236
|Class S common stock | February 23,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 21,517
|Class S common stock | March 22,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 22,651
|Class S common stock | April 23,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 35,655
|Class S common stock | May 22, 2023 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 24,985
|Class S common stock | June 26, 2023 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 26,216
|Class S common stock | July 24,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 41,249
|Class S common stock | August 22,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 28,185
|Class S common stock | September 25,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 29,198
|Class S common stock | October 24,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 45,420
|Class D common stock
|Class of Stock [Line Items]
|Distribution Amount
|40,726
|31,930
|Class D common stock | February 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|3,499
|Class D common stock | March 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|3,794
|Class D common stock | April 24,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|5,767
|Class D common stock | May 23,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|3,966
|Class D common stock | June 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|3,988
|Class D common stock | July 24,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|5,749
|Class D common stock | O 2025 M7 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|3,972
|Class D common stock | O 2025 M8 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|4,004
|Class D common stock | O 2025 M9 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|5,987
|Class D common stock | February 23,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|2,829
|Class D common stock | March 22,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|2,984
|Class D common stock | April 23,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|4,144
|Class D common stock | May 22, 2023 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|2,868
|Class D common stock | June 26, 2023 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|3,105
|Class D common stock | July 24,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|4,646
|Class D common stock | August 22,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|3,184
|Class D common stock | September 25,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|3,267
|Class D common stock | October 24,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|4,903
|Class I common stock
|Class of Stock [Line Items]
|Distribution Amount
|$ 853,702
|$ 537,157
|Class I common stock | February 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 69,929
|Class I common stock | March 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 72,626
|Class I common stock | April 24,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 111,979
|Class I common stock | May 23,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 79,647
|Class I common stock | June 25,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 82,474
|Class I common stock | July 24, 2025 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 121,070
|Class I common stock | O 2025 M7 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|$ 86,089
|Class I common stock | O 2025 M8 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|$ 92,287
|Class I common stock | O 2025 M9 Dividends
|Class of Stock [Line Items]
|Distribution Amount
|$ 137,601
|Class I common stock | February 23,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 42,089
|Class I common stock | March 22,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 44,196
|Class I common stock | April 23,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 67,452
|Class I common stock | May 22, 2023 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 49,096
|Class I common stock | June 26, 2023 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 51,937
|Class I common stock | July 24,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 78,628
|Class I common stock | August 22,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 56,502
|Class I common stock | September 25,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 58,767
|Class I common stock | October 24, 2024 Payment Date
|Class of Stock [Line Items]
|Distribution Amount
|$ 88,490
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Aggregate dividends declared during the period for each share of common stock outstanding.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of paid and unpaid common stock dividends declared with the form of settlement in cash.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details